Sandalwood is a class of woods from trees in the genus Santalum. The woods are heavy, yellow, and fine-grained, and, unlike many other aromatic woods, they retain their fragrance for decades. Sandalwood oil is extracted from the woods for use. WitrynaEssential components of sandalwood essential oil are sesquiterpene ethers, (+)-cis-α-santanol and (-)-cis-β-santanol, which are present in the amount of 65-72% (up to 90% according to other sources). These two … Witryna17 kwi 2024 · Sandalwood does not smell spicey, piney, sweet or turpey at all. These typical sandalwood smell associations are from cedar or other woods or spice that are often mixed with sandalwood. Sandalwood is a gentle creamy scent with an effortlessly elevating almost unnoticeable resinous body.
